    Sep 18, 2017 · Codeman1980, please refer to KB 2147650 (Important information about the new ESXi 6.5 USB driver vmkusb, and the legacy USB drivers (2147650) VMware KB) for more details, but briefly with vSphere 6.5 we have a new integrated USB driver that is named "vmkusb". You can verify that it is loaded with "vmkload_mod -l grep -i usb".

    USB physical bus topology defines how USB devices connect to the host. Support for USB device passthrough to a virtual machine is available if the physical bus topology of the device on the host does not exceed tier seven. The first tier is the USB host controller …

    Sep 26, 2012 · VMware ESXi 5.1 has USB 3.0 support, but it's currently limited to using the vSphere Web Client to map client-side USB 3.0 devices to the remote VM. Long story short, turns out ESXi 5.1 doesn't really support USB 3.0 in the way you might think. In other words, if your system running ESXi 5.1 has USB 3.0 ports, that's nice!

    ESXi hosts must have USB controller hardware and modules that support USB 3.0, 2.0, and 1.1 devices present. Client computers must have USB controller hardware and modules that support USB 3.0, 2.0, and 1.1 devices present. To use the xHCI controller on a Linux guest, ensure that the Linux kernel version is 2.6.35 or later.
